You'd have to add (the correct) animations to the CAppearanceDef of the hero.

It's kinda complicated, since the hero has about 850 animations if I remember correct.

There are two ways:
1.
Swap the ID's of the animations you want between the hero and Thunder, they are in the graphics.big (they start with ANIM_).

2.
There's an application for working with animations and the CAppearanceDef (adding and removing them) here.
But keep in mind that none of us has done a lot with it, so there is little support for the app.

BlueTooth used the app to add the staff animations to the hero. (That mod can be found here.)
I would suggest taking a look at that, and the difference with the original CAppearanceDef of the hero.

So in very simple terms:
I think what you'd need to do is export the CAppearanceDef of Thunder and the hero (with fable explorer listed in the CDefs of the CREATURE_HERO and CREATURE_RIVAL_HERO_THUNDER).
And 'copy and paste' the animations you want from Thunder to the hero.
